They often feature decorative elements such as flourishes or geometric patterns and may use metallic or high-contrast color schemes. Art Deco fonts also tend to be highly stylized and may incorporate elongation. They typically have a strong vertical emphasis and may incorporate zigzags, chevrons, and sunbursts. Features Of Art Deco FontsĪrt Deco fonts are known for their sleek and geometric design, often featuring clean lines and bold shapes. Today, Art Deco typography is still appreciated for its unique style and continues to influence modern design trends. It was often handy to convey a sense of modernity, luxury, and sophistication. Bold geometric shapes, streamlined forms, and sans-serif fonts characterized this typography style.Īrt Deco typography was popular in advertising, posters, and other forms of graphic design. The Art Deco movement originated in Europe and quickly spread worldwide.
